Lucidworks Fusion SME
HarmonyTech Inc. looking for a Lucidworks Fusion SME to lead the design and optimization of enterprise search solutions. This role requires strong expertise in Lucidworks Fusion, Apache Solr, and relevance tuning to build scalable and high-performing search platforms. The ideal candidate will design, implement, and optimize search solutions using Lucidworks Fusion to deliver high-performance, scalable, and intelligent search experiences.
Position is based in the National Capital Region (Washington DC, Maryland, Virginia) and requires U.S. citizenship.
Key Responsibilities:-
- Design, develop, and maintain search solutions using Lucidworks Fusion and Apache Solr.
- Configure and optimize pipelines, signals, and query processing for relevance tuning.
- Implement data ingestion workflows from multiple structured and unstructured data sources.
- Develop and manage Fusion apps, collections, and indexing strategies.
- Perform relevance tuning using signals, synonyms, and machine learning models.
- Integrate Fusion with enterprise systems (CMS, eCommerce platforms, APIs, databases).
- Monitor system performance and troubleshoot issues related to search and indexing.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
- Provide technical leadership and best practices for search architecture.
- Strong hands-on experience with Lucidworks Fusion.
- Expertise in Apache Solr, indexing, and query optimization.
- Experience with Java, Python, or similar programming languages.
- Knowledge of REST APIs, JSON, and data integration techniques.
- Experience with relevance tuning, boosting, ranking, and signals.
- Familiarity with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
- Strong understanding of search architecture and distributed systems.
- Experience with machine learning in search/recommendation systems.
- Knowledge of Kafka, Spark, or streaming technologies.
- Experience in eCommerce or large-scale content platforms.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.
- Good communication and stakeholder management.
- 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ment.
- Lucidworks Fusion certification.
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
- Master’s degree preferred but not required.
